Ticket: missed pick-up of score sheets from the Westmere Regional Chess Final. Heads up, records team — the courier never showed Saturday, so the sheets are still sitting with the arbiter at the Halloway Club. Re-booked for tomorrow morning. When the new courier arrives, apply this hand-over instruction:

dispatch memo: the lamwyn fenwyn courier leaves the wenir ledger at gate 7175 under passcode 822969

Handover note — Crumbwheel order cutoffs.

Welcome aboard. The bakery cutoff rule in Crumbwheel closes same-day orders at 14:00 local to each storefront, not UTC — this has bitten us twice. Holiday overrides live in the calendar service and take precedence silently, so always check there first when a cutoff looks wrong. To unlock the calendar service's admin console after a restart, enter the recovery passphrase below.

vault phrase of bagap-bahaf = silion-pelox-sorox-casdor-quenwyn-fraax-eliox-praael-kelion-quenvan-kasox-rusael-norius-belvan

### Checkout load test returns 403s

The Cartwheel gateway rejects unauthenticated load-test traffic by design. Synthetic checkout runs must present a bearer token scoped to `loadtest:checkout`, minted from the Cartwheel staging vault. Tokens expire after two hours. Do not reuse production credentials. The current staging load-test token is:

session JWT of yawep-yawep = eyJhbGciOiJIUzI1NiIsInR5cCI6IkpXVCJ9.eyJzdWIiOiI3pWF3_In0.aXYsHiog

### Restarting the Quellbox deduplicator

If duplicate pages are reaching on-call, the Quellbox dedup worker has likely lost its fingerprint cache. First confirm via the `dedup_cache_hits` graph, then drain the worker pool before restarting — a hard restart mid-window re-fires suppressed alerts. After restart, re-seed the cache by calling the internal replay endpoint, which authenticates with the key below.

gateway credential: kto23_dolYgAScEh2TaPOlStqOl98